The equation of a circle in standard form is

(x - h)² + (y - k)² = r²

where (h, k) are the coordinates of the centre and r is the radius

The centre is at the midpoint of the endpoints of the diameter.

Using the midpoint formula with (- 1, 2) and (7, - 4), then

centre = ( \frac{-1+7}{2} , \frac{2-4}{2} ) = (3, - 1 )

The radius is the distance from the centre to either of the endpoints of the diameter.

Using the distance formula

r = \sqrt{(x_{2}-x_{1})^2+(y_{2}-y_{1})^2    }

with (x₁, y₁ ) = (3, - 1) and (x₂, y₂ ) = (- 1, 2)

r = \sqrt{(3+1)^2+(2+1)^2}

  = \sqrt{4^2+3^2}

  = \sqrt{16+9} = \sqrt{25} = 5

Thus

(x - 3)² + (y - (- 1))² = 5² , that is

(x - 3)² + (y + 1)² = 25 ← equation of circle
